‘Vampire Zombies From Space’ Trailer – ’50s B-Movie Satire Invades Earth This Month
A send-up to the halcyon days of black-and-white creature features, Vampire Zombies… From Space! will invade Blu-ray and DVD on January 20 via Cleopatra Entertainment.
The campy sci-fi horror comedy draws inspiration from Mel Brooks, Ed Wood, and South Park, all of which are apparent in the batty trailer below.
Canadian filmmaker Michael Stasko directs from a script he co-wrote with Jakob Skrzypa and Alex Forman.
Jessica Antovski, Rashaun Baldeo, Andrew Bee, Oliver Georgiou, Craig Gloster, and Simon Reynolds (Saw VI) star.
It features appearances by Judith O’Dea (Night of the Living Dead), David Liebe Hart (“Tim and Eric Awesome Show, Great Job!”), and Troma President Lloyd Kaufman as Public Masturbator.
